Have you played in the Gears of War 3 beta yet? Even a single, solitary game? If so – bam! – you just earned another access code to share, sell or selfishly hoard all to yourself. For the final week of the multiplayer, starting on May 8 and ending on May 15, Epic and Microsoft are enabling players already in the beta to invite one more person into the fray.
With a little extra work, however – or a little extra money – you can invite up to FIVE friends and family members. Here’s how…
